What is the average salary in Chino, CA?
The average salary in Chino, CA, stands at $57,237 per year. This figure reflects the diverse job market in the area, offering competitive pay across various industries. Job seekers can find opportunities in sectors like retail, healthcare, and manufacturing, all contributing to the overall average salary.
Chino's salary distribution shows a range of earnings. The most common salary falls between $33,000 and $44,806. Higher-paying jobs, such as those in management and specialized fields, can reach up to $151,057 per year. This variety ensures that professionals with different skills and experience levels can find suitable positions.

How does the cost of living in Chino, CA compare to the national average?

The cost of living in Chino, California, shows some significant differences when compared to the nationwide average. Housing costs in Chino stand at 155, which is 55% higher than the national average. This means that residents will need to allocate a larger portion of their budget to housing compared to the average American. While this might be a consideration for job seekers, Chino also offers competitive prices in other areas.
For instance, groceries in Chino are priced at 102, which is only 2% higher than the national average. This indicates that food expenses remain relatively close to what one might expect across the country. Utilities, at 107, also show a modest 7% increase. Transportation costs are slightly higher, at 110, which is 10% above the average. Healthcare costs in Chino are at 115, reflecting an increase of 15%. Miscellaneous expenses, at 120, are 20% higher than the national average. Overall, while housing is notably more expensive, other living costs in Chino remain fairly comparable to the nationwide average.
